What Is Withdrawal and How Does It Occur?

Withdrawal is a physiological and psychological response that occurs when someone reduces or stops using a substance they’ve become dependent on. This process is often linked to substance abuse, where the body adapts to the presence of a drug or alcohol. When the substance is removed, the brain and body struggle to regain balance, leading to withdrawal symptoms. These symptoms can vary widely depending on the substance, duration of use, and individual health factors. Common Withdrawal Symptoms Across Substances

  • For alcohol and benzodiazepines, symptoms often include tremors, anxiety, insomnia, and seizures.
  • Opioid withdrawal may involve muscle aches, nausea, sweating, and intense cravings.
  • Stimulant withdrawal, such as from cocaine or amphetamines, can trigger fatigue, depression, and increased appetite.

Factors That Influence Withdrawal Severity

Mental health plays a critical role in determining how severe withdrawal symptoms will be. Individuals with pre-existing conditions like depression or anxiety may experience more intense psychological effects. Additionally, the duration and frequency of substance use, genetic predispositions, and overall physical health contribute to withdrawal severity. Medical vs. Psychological Withdrawal: Key Differences

Medical withdrawal involves physical symptoms like headaches, rapid heartbeat, or gastrointestinal distress. Psychological withdrawal, on the other hand, includes cravings, mood swings, and cognitive impairments. Both types often overlap, making it challenging to distinguish them. Addiction treatment programs typically address both aspects through medication, therapy, and lifestyle adjustments. Recognizing these differences helps tailor effective coping strategies for long-term recovery.

When to Seek Professional Help for Withdrawal

Withdrawal can be dangerous, especially with substances like alcohol or benzodiazepines, which may cause life-threatening symptoms. If symptoms persist for more than a few days or escalate to severe anxiety, hallucinations, or dehydration, immediate medical attention is necessary. Professional addiction treatment centers provide supervised detox programs, ensuring safety and comfort during the withdrawal phase. Early intervention also reduces the risk of relapse and supports long-term mental health.

Effective Coping Strategies During Withdrawal

  • Stay hydrated and maintain a balanced diet to support physical recovery.
  • Engage in regular exercise to alleviate stress and boost endorphins naturally.
  • Join support groups or therapy sessions to address psychological withdrawal symptoms.

Prevention and Long-Term Management of Withdrawal

Preventing future withdrawal episodes requires addressing the root causes of substance abuse through comprehensive addiction treatment. This includes behavioral therapy, medication-assisted treatment (MAT), and relapse prevention planning. Building a strong support network and adopting healthy coping strategies can mitigate the risk of dependency. Prioritizing mental health through ongoing therapy and self-care practices also strengthens resilience against triggers.

Debunking Myths About Withdrawal

A common misconception is that withdrawal is purely a physical process. In reality, mental health is deeply intertwined with the experience. Another myth is that willpower alone can manage withdrawal symptoms, which often leads to relapse. Effective addiction treatment combines professional guidance with personalized coping strategies to ensure sustainable recovery. Understanding these truths helps individuals approach withdrawal with realistic expectations and proactive support.
